Simone Zaccaron is a researcher at the forefront of neurorehabilitation, specializing in spinal cord injury (SCI) and the restoration of motor function through advanced assistive technologies. Their work focuses on the intersection of robotic training systems and neuromodulation, particularly spinal cord epidural stimulation (scES), to improve postural control and mobility in individuals with severe paralysis. In a pivotal 2024 pilot study, Zaccaron demonstrated that combining robotic postural stand training with scES can significantly enhance sitting postural control in patients with high-level SCI—a critical step toward greater independence and quality of life.
